Integrated drill rod detection flushing device and construction method for old pile foundation
The invention discloses an integrated drill rod detection flushing device and a construction method for an old pile foundation. The bottom of a drill rod of an inner sleeve facility is an angle drill, and the angle drill is in a cone shape with the wide upper portion and the narrow lower portion; the outer guide pipe of the jacket facility is connected with the water injection pipe and the pressurizing device through a three-way pipe; a certain gap between the drill rod and the guide pipe is used for injecting high-pressure water between inner and outer sleeve gaps for the pressurizing device; the drill rod and the guide pipe are connected in a welded mode, the drill rod is connected in a threaded mode, and the guide pipe is connected in a screwed mode. The purposes that holes are formed in the peripheries of a single pile and multiple piles at the same time, and soil around the piles absorbs water to be dispersed and cracks into fragments and particles are achieved; after pile body soil is separated from the pile, a hole is formed in the middle suitable position below the exposed pile top through a water drill, a high-strength steel pipe with the same size as the hole and a hoisting machinery steel wire rope penetrate into the hole to hoist the old pile out, and the problem that disturbance is caused to the structural safety of surrounding buildings in the pile foundation treatment process is solved.
